In her end-of-year exams, Jennie scored the following: Science 34%, English 90%, History 87%, Math 34%, and Geography 55%. What

was the mean?

Answer:

The mean was 60%.

Explanation:

The mean is the average of your numbers. To calculate the mean you would have to add all the numbers together. Then, you’d divide your total amount by how many numbers you had to add together. For this example, you would add 34+90+87+34+55. This gives you a total of 300. Since you had 5 initial numbers, you would divide 300 by 5. You will come up with a final number of 60 which is your mean.
